Unit II Chapter — 2 Non-Linear Wave Shaping: Diode clippers, Transistor clipperes, Clipping at two independent levels, Transfer characteristics of clippers, Emitter coupled clipper, Comparators, Applications of voltage comparators, Clamping operation, Clamping circuits using diode with different inputs, Clamping circuit theorem, Practical clamping circuits, Effect of diode characteristics on clamping voltage, Transfer characteristics of clampers.

Unit III Chapters — 3, 4 Switching Characteristics of Devices: Diode and transistor as switches, Break down voltage consideration of transistor, Saturation parameters of transistor and their variation with temperature, Design of transistors switch, Transistor-switching times.

Unit IV Chapter — 5 Multivibrators: Analysis and design of bistable multivibrators : Fixed bias and self biased transistor binary, Commutating capacitors, Triggering in binary, Schmitt trigger circuit, Applications.

Unit V Chapter — 5 Multivibrators Cotnd. Unit VI Chapter — 6 Time Base Generators: General features of a time base signal, Methods of generating time base waveform, Miller and bootstrap time base generators — Basic principles, Transistor miller time base generator, Transistor bootstrap time base generator, Current time base generators. Unit VII Chapter — 7 Synchronization and Frequency Division: Principles of synchronization, Frequency division in sweep circuit, Astable relaxation circuits, Monostable relaxation circuits, Phase delay and phase jitters; Synchronization of a sweep circuit with symmetrical signals, Sine wave frequency division with a sweep circuit.
